The Origins of Welcome Bonuses: From Traditional Sign-Up Offers to Modern Incentives
Initial online casino marketing heavily relied on straightforward sign-up bonuses—often offering match bonuses on deposits. While effective, these incentives faced increasing regulatory scrutiny for their promotional intensity and the potential for encouraging irresponsible gambling. As a result, operators diversified their offerings, leading to the emergence of no deposit bonuses.
“A no deposit bonus is essentially an introductory gift—allowing players to explore a platform without risking their own funds, while providing operators with a chance to showcase their offerings.”
The Significance of no deposit bonus in Industry Strategy
Today, **no deposit bonuses** stand as one of the most credible and recognizable introductory offers for online casinos. Unlike traditional deposit-based bonuses, these incentives enable players to redeem free spins or bonus cash immediately upon registration. This approach reduces entry barriers, particularly for new players who may be hesitant to invest without first testing the platform’s quality and game diversity.

Strategic Challenges and Opportunities for Operators
Despite their appeal, no deposit bonuses come with inherent challenges:
- Higher Wagering Requirements: Many offers include stringent playthrough conditions, which can frustrate players.
- Maximum Cashout Limits: Operators often cap winnings from free spins or bonus cash, which can diminish perceived value.
- Expense Management: Free bonuses are a cost-effective way to acquire players but require balancing with profitability.
To maximize the benefits, operators increasingly integrate **personalized bonus offers**, transparent terms, and flexible wagering requirements. Data analytics now allow for targeted promotional strategies that lead to better player retention without diminishing margins.
